Output 8ad96e4256ee3dd7c60c8371a31d8d90feedde7cab4569a31cee5bf2ee9e5e64:0

value
669362
script pubkey
OP_0 OP_PUSHBYTES_20 350d5b7e8be71df33791552af1060901322e9c88
address
bc1qx5x4kl5tuuwlxdu32540zpsfqyeza8yg77m02v
transaction
8ad96e4256ee3dd7c60c8371a31d8d90feedde7cab4569a31cee5bf2ee9e5e64
spent
true